Why India is refusing permanent refuge to Afghans? | Raj Ki Baat
After the Taliban took over Afghanistan, along with nationals of other countries, Afghan locals also left their homeland. The US, Indians and others conducted rescue operations and bring back as many as possible people from Kabul. Now, as India has already been accommodating refugees from Myanmar, it's not possible for them to give permanent refuge to Afghans. They have also protested asking about the refugee status but, the Indian government has so far not taken any step.
